Surface compatibility
Recommended surfaces: smooth well-bonded tiles, flat walls, even countertops, kitchen fronts, lacquered or melamine furniture in good condition, and tables or tops with a firm substrate.
Precautions before installation: avoid heavy textured walls, dusty or greasy surfaces, exposed silicone, flaking paint or unstable substrates. On floors, it is not the best option for areas with constant dragging of heavy furniture.
Micro FAQ
- Can it be installed on countertops and kitchen splashbacks?
Yes, as long as the surface is smooth, stable and properly prepared. In kitchens it combines true waterproof performance with fire-rated behaviour and a light, elegant mineral look. - Which finish is recommended for bathroom floors?
The R10 anti-slip version is the recommended option for floors. It is especially intended for residential bathrooms and areas without frequent furniture dragging. - How should it be cleaned in kitchens or showers?
Use a soft cloth or a non-abrasive sponge with water and regular cleaning products. Aggressive scouring pads should be avoided to preserve the finish. - Can it handle frequent cleaning and continuous humidity?
Yes, it is designed for regular maintenance in kitchens and bathrooms. It supports steam, continuous humidity and repeated cleaning without losing colour stability or surface definition. - Which surfaces work best?
It adheres best to smooth, stable and well-bonded substrates. Smooth tiles, skim-coated walls, stable melamine, lacquered surfaces and even countertops usually provide the best result.
